Abstract
Taking the corrupted old film as the research object, this paper proposed a new video restoration method based on improved PatchMatch and low-rank matrix recovery. Our method is divided into three steps. Firstly, we divide each frame in the video sequence into image patches with overlap region, and similar interframe patches are found using the proposed improved PatchMatch algorithm. Then, the low-rank matrix recovery is used to separate the patch group into low-rank matrix component and sparse error component. Finally, synthesizing the video frame by the recorded location of patches, and completing the multi-frame joint automatic restoration frame by frame. The proposed method has been tested on a set of old film sequences in this paper. Experiment demonstrates that it is an effective method for corrupted old film restoration.
